World Centres Closure for 2021

WAGGGS has announced the decision to temporarily close Our Chalet, Pax Lodge, Sangam and Kusafiri. Guías de México have also decided to close Nuestra Cabaña, which means that all the World Centres will now be closed until 2022.

Included below is the message received from the Chair of the World Board and the WAGGGS CEO:

In early 2020, our world changed in ways that few could have foreseen. Since the COVID-19 outbreak in March we have all had to find new ways of working and adapt to the huge changes which have affected the whole Movement.

In March 2020, WAGGGS made the difficult decision to temporarily close the World Centres in order to keep staff, guests, and the local community safe during the COVID-19 pandemic. All volunteers, and where necessary international staff, were repatriated. Whilst the centres have been closed, the amazing World Centre team has continued to show great commitment and passion. They have successfully engaged supporters through social media campaigns, offering bespoke tours, running online events and more. At the same time, they have ensured the security and safety of the centres.

We had very much hoped that all centres would be able to accept guests and restart face-to face activities by January 2021. However, due to the growing numbers of new COVID-19 infections around the world, and the uncertainty about guests’ appetite for travel it is not realistic to keep the centres open in 2021.

In light of this, and with the aim of preserving these vital resources for the future benefit of the Movement, we have made the very difficult decision to temporarily close Our Chalet, Pax Lodge, Sangam and Kusafiri. Guías de México have also decided to close Nuestra Cabaña, which means that all of the World Centres will now be closed until 2022. We will focus on retaining institutional knowledge, keeping the centres secure and properly maintained, and securing bookings for future visits in order to reopen successfully in 2022. This of course was a very difficult decision but one which is unfortunately necessary to ensure the long-term sustainability of our World Centres for the Movement. During this time these Centres will not be open to the public and we will be doing everything we can to keep costs as low as possible. We will maintain a skeleton operation to ensure the safety of the centres while our focus now will be to ensure a strong recovery in 2022.

We hope to be able to welcome you and your members back to the Centres in 2022. We will be taking bookings for 2022 throughout 2021.
